WebInfrasound. Infrasound is defined as: Sound waves with a frequency below the human hearing range of 20 Hz. The spectrum of sound waves, including infrasound and ultrasound, is shown in the image below: The human ear can detect sounds between around 20 and 20 000 Hz in frequency with a peak sensitivity at around 4000 Hz. Waves transfer energy from one place to another when particles, or electric and magnetic fields, vibrate.
